Aledade’s New Jersey ACO to manage care for 20k+ Horizon BCBS members

Aledade, a value-based care network operating ACOs across 18 states, will coordinate care for Horizon Blue Cross Blue Shield of New Jersey’s commercially insured and Medicare Advantage members.

Under the agreement, physicians in Aledade’s New Jersey ACO will be held accountable for improving the health outcomes of their Horizon patients. Physicians will be rewarded for reaching certain quality and cost-containment targets. More than 20,000 Horizon members are expected to participate in the collaboration.

In August 2017, Aledade revealed plans to form a primary care physician-led ACO in New Jersey in January 2018.
